Is Library Science the Worst Degree among all Degrees?

Respected Professionals,

I have come to know and my self had face this situation. Librarianship today is in its extreme critical situation. I cant blame to government and officials for its conditions but I think that we are also responsible for it. Our national and international level unions are busy only in their meetings, conferences, seminars and workshops all works are going under form of papers, nothing is going on real surfaces. Many unions are running in only papers there is no identity of library associations in this country. There are a few professional who give their precious time for the sake of profession. I call all the library professional under one roof and roar for their rights otherwise the day is not so far when library and librarianship will disappear from the list of profession.

Of course 'yes', because, It is the only degree that any one can get for which they should spend one year for UG and another One yr for PG. That too it is easily available through 'CORRESS'. Any tom, dick and harry, if they need one 'OPTIONAL' they can do 'LIS'.

To make it the best, first of all, it should be a regular 3 year degree course for UG and 2 year degree course for PG. And it should be under the faculty of Sc and Tech, a Library and Information Science (that is B.Sc (LIS) and M.Sc (LIS)). And no more 'Corress' to be continued.

for pay structure, Leave and all other benefits, the professors of library, should be treated as teaching staff and we don't want the words like 'at par with' or the non-teaching or non-vocational staff, etc.

Otherwise, both the LIS degree and the status of the so called librarians will be the Worst.  To do so, we shall need a strong leader like Dr.S.R.Ranganathan, to represent UGC.

It is not only matter of quality of Library Science course and knowledge of person but it is also matter of value of Library science degree and value of librarian in the Institute and their salary. Many qualified and knowledgeable professional working in private institute are getting low salary due to low value of librarians.

Therefore if you got government job then your degree is valuable otherwise. I want to share one real case:

Two Friends did M.Sc. in Mathematics with first class. One is joined as Faculty for Mathematics and second joined as librarian after two year because He did M.Lib. after M.Sc. Now after 10 years first

person(faculty) is getting 40000 salary and second person(librarian) is getting only 19000 salary in the

same institute. Second person(librarian) is now realize his mistake to get library science degree and choosing their career in library science.
